Dedication ceremony of the new fields at Sycamore Drive
More than 300 St. Margaret’s School students, faculty, staff, parents, board members, neighbors, and
alumnae came together on October 12th, 2007 to officially dedicate the school’s new athletic complex.

Head of School Margaret R. Broad was joined by Chaplain Candine Johnson, Board Chair Jill McCuan, Athletic Director Sue Haney, and keynote speaker Heather Wood Mantz for the official dedication of the St. Margaret’s School athletic complex on October 12. Mantz, an athletic standout while at St. Margaret’s, also serves on the School’s Board of Governors and is a graduate of the Class of 1987.

“Most people would give anything to feel like a god for one minute of their life,” said Mantz, currently the Director of Environmental Affairs for the Virginia Port Authority, quoting from the movie Hoosiers. “St. Margaret’s School gives you that opportunity, whether it’s on this ‘field of dreams,’ on a stage, in a crew shell, or in the classroom.”

Earlier this year, the Board unanimously approved the request to begin construction on the 42-acre property which the school purchased four years ago. Located on Sycamore Drive in Tappahannock, the complex is being developed in phases. It currently houses two playing fields, two softball diamonds, a cross-country track, and a faculty residence.

Area contractors, suppliers, and professionals working on the project include The Contractor Yard, Essex Concrete, and Lowe’s, all of Tappahannock; Pritchard & Fallon of Callao; and S.R. Jones Construction of Montross.

The dedication was followed by the third and final field hockey game between the St. Margaret’s Scotties and the Essex Trojans. SMS won 6-0.
